Combustion of Powdered Metals in Active Media
Abstract
This book deals with the subject of igniting and burning such metals as aluminum, beryllium, magnesium, boron, lithium and others. These mistakes are used to improve the physical and chemical characteristics of rocket propellants. Extensive experimental and theoretical material obtained by Soviet and foreign authors during the last 10-15 years is presented and generalized. Contemporary research methods and the basic rules of metal ignition and burning are discussed. The effect of metal additives on physical and energy parameters of powders and explosives is discussed.
